  Description     : An environment for authoring TeX (LaTeX, ConTeXt, etc) 
documents

 An environment for authoring TeX (LaTeX, ConTeXt, etc) documents, with
 a Unicode-based, TeX-aware editor, integrated PDF viewer, and a clean,
 simple interface accessible to casual and non-technical users.
 .
 TeXworks is inspired by Dick Koch's award-winning TeXShop program for
 Mac OS X, which has made quality typesetting through TeX accessible to
 a wider community of users, without a technical or intimidating face.
 The goal of TeXworks is to deliver a similarly integrated, easy-to-use
 environment for users on other platforms, especially GNU/Linux and Windows.


Jonathan Kew is very famous for his XeTeX and texworks is
also his work.  Although I have not used TeXShop but heard 
that it is an excellent tool.  We will enjoy a similar excellent
texworks.  As far as I tested my private package, it could
display multi-byte characters like CJK in its pdf-viewer and
its most notable feature is synctex support IMHO.
